What Matters Most

District, not city, determines teacher pay. Two school districts in the same metro can differ by $10,000-15,000 in starting salary, with similar differences in benefits and retirement contributions.

Pro Tip

Factor in pension value when comparing teaching to private sector work. A defined-benefit pension earning 2% per year of service over a 30-year career is worth $500,000-1,000,000 in present value.

Common Mistake

Looking at base salary alone. Many districts pay stipends for coaching, department chair duties, National Board certification, and advanced degrees — these can add $3,000-12,000/year.

Best Time to Buy

Teacher hiring peaks in March-May for the following school year. Districts often post positions earlier, but most interviewing and offers happen in this window.

Daytona Beach vs State & National Average

CategoryDaytona BeachFlorida AvgNational Avg
Average salary$40,599$42,352$55,000
Low estimate$29,526$31,764$41,250
High estimate$51,671$55,058$71,500

FL Tax & Regulatory Impact

📋 State-Level Cost Factor

Florida's lack of state income tax is a major draw, but homeowners face property insurance premiums 3-5x the national average due to hurricane risk. Factor this into any cost comparison.
